After City’s midweek exploits against Red Star Belgrade, it’s back to league action as the blues host Nottingham Forest at the Etihad Stadium. The visitors will be hoping to end City’s 100% start to the season, while the blues will be hoping for another three points to keep Liverpool and Spurs at bay.

And, each week, our team give their views on how they think the match will go and offer their predictions. Here’s how the guys think the match will pan out.

Craig

Forest look to be quite stable and ready to consolidate themselves as a Premier League club. They have the talent, like all Premier League teams do, to make things interesting against City, but I don’t see it. Pep’s boys are looking flawless right now. Forest tend to concede on the road. They got pumped 6-0 at the Etihad last season. I see something similar transpiring this weekend.

City 4-0 Nottingham Forest

Dillon

I’ve seen the phrase banana skin thrown around to describe City’s past few opponents. However, this current City side has shown time and time again they have the ability to grind out results and no one in the squad will forget what Forest pulled off last season.

Yes the squad’s light. Yes there are injuries in multiple positions. But City have shown so much resilience since the start of their run dating back to February/March. They just seem unstoppable.

Forest aren’t playing badly and are quite a good side, so much depends on the team available to City and whether they start to take their chances. The blues aren’t far off treble figures in shots but are struggling to convert. That said, three at West Ham and against Red Star was enough to see them home and I think they’ll have enough on Saturday.

I’m expecting a Forest goal. I don’t know why, but City seem to enjoy conceding goals in the first half of the season, but I expect the blues will take the points.

City 4-1 Forest
